iMate JAQ4 Gets Official, Slightly More

imatejaq4.jpgCompared to the product renders we saw in December, the official i-Mate JAQ4 looks quite a bit better. It's straighter, squarer, and blacker'€"a transformation not seen since Steve Urkel drank Boss Sauce and turned into Stefan Urquelle. As for the phone itself, there's GPS, quad-band GSM, the front QWERTY, a 2.8-inch touchscreen, 64MB RAM, 128MB ROM, miniSD expansion, 200MHz OMAP processor, 802.11b/g WiFi, 2-megapixel auto-focus camera, Bluetooth 1.2, and the whole thing runs on Windows Mobile 6 Crossbow. All in all, the specs aren't THAT impressive, but it's a solid phone that features the next mobile OS from Microsoft. '€" Jason Chen i-Mate JAQ4 [i-Mate]
